CVE-2017-7313 describes an unauthenticated information disclosure vulnerability in Personify360 e-Business versions 7.5.2 through 7.6.1. By accessing a specific URI, attackers can retrieve customer names, master customer IDs, and email addresses without needing to authenticate. This high-severity vulnerability (CVSS 7.5) has a low attack complexity and allows for full confidentiality impact, though integrity and availability are not affected. There is no evidence of active exploitation, nor are there publicly available exploit modules or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
